Llyra
Llyra is a ruthless Lemurian villain and longtime adversary of Namor the Sub-Mariner, using cunning and shapeshifting abilities to scheme against Atlantis and its allies from the depths of Marvel's undersea world.
Born from the depths of the Bronze Age, Llyra made her sinister splash in Sub-Mariner #36 in 1971, and Marvel's underwater corners have never quite been the same. She's a villain with real staying power — 53 years in the catalog, two key-issue appearances to her name, and a rogues' gallery résumé that puts her in the same pages as Namor, Captain America, Susan Storm Richards, and even the Watcher himself, Uatu. Her heaviest footprint falls across Fantastic Four Annual, Iron Man Annual, and the sprawling Atlantis Attacks Omnibus, marking her as a fixture of Marvel's aquatic mythology rather than a footnote.
